PROJECT OVERVIEW
As part of the Airbus-led SESAME (Sustainable, Efficient, Safe Air Travel by Management and Engineering) initiative, my team was selected to partner with Delta Air Lines to investigate efficiency and sustainability opportunities within international catering operations. I explored how UX design, product design, and design research can improve experiences within Delta Air Lines’s international catering systems. The focus was on applying product thinking, systems thinking, and service design methodologies to identify opportunities for data-driven, digital, sustainable, and passenger-centered innovation.
